About Wenhao Wu

Wenhao Wu is a scholar working on Computer Vision and Pattern Recognition, Polymers and Plastics and Bioengineering, having authored 33 papers that have together received 287 indexed citations. Recurring topics across this work include Advanced Neural Network Applications (6 papers), Transition Metal Oxide Nanomaterials (5 papers) and Video Surveillance and Tracking Methods (5 papers). The work is most often cited by research in Bioengineering (31 citations), Polymers and Plastics (52 citations) and Structural Biology (4 citations). Wenhao Wu has collaborated with scholars based in China, Hong Kong and United States. Frequent co-authors include Jiran Liang, Qun Lou, Hau−San Wong, Mengyun Wu, Si Wu, Zongwei Xu, Fengzhou Fang, Haiying Yang, Yang Liu and Ping Yang. Their work appears in journals such as SHILAP Revista de lepidopterología, ACS Applied Materials & Interfaces and IEEE Transactions on Geoscience and Remote Sensing.
